Audit a backlink profile using Ahrefs MCP data: profile health, anchor text distribution, toxic link identification, lost link reclamation, and gap analysis against competitors. Use this skill when reviewing backlink health, scoping a disavow project, recovering from a manual action, planning link building, or doing M&A due diligence on a property's link equity. Triggers on backlink audit, link profile, toxic links, disavow, anchor text analysis, lost links, link reclamation, referring domains, link gap. Also triggers when traffic decline correlates with link loss or when an unnatural link warning appears in Search Console.

The skill exposes the agent to untrusted, user-generated content from public third-party sources, creating a risk of indirect prompt injection. This includes browsing arbitrary URLs, reading social media posts or forum comments, and analyzing content from unknown websites.
Third-party content exposure detected (high risk: 0.80). The skill explicitly instructs pulling referring domains, anchor text, link types, lost links and competitor overlap "Pull from Ahrefs" (SKILL.md and the 5-dimension sections), which ingests public third-party website data/UGC via the Ahrefs index that the agent must read and act on (e.g., build toxic/disavow and reclamation lists), so untrusted web content can materially influence decisions and tool actions.
